Should the peak voltage on pin CS exceed 1.6V
at any time during dimming, the IR2159 enters
FAULT mode and the high and low-side driver
outputs, HO and LO, are both turned off . Cycling
the supply voltage on VCC below or the voltage
on pin SD will reset the IR2159 to preheat (PH)
mode (see STATE DIAGRAM).
